MEMO — Second-Source Supplier Search

Welcome aboard! Quick context before your first ops sync: we currently rely on Varnholt Plastics for every Kestrel housing, and that's made us nervous since their spring shutdown. Priya's team shortlisted three alternates, with Dovecote Moulding the front-runner on cost and lead time. Nothing signed yet. Before you weigh in, read the note below.

board note of kageg-bahof: The renewal with Holwynax Holdings closes at $2 million a year, 5 percent below the last contract. Project Ulaath slips by two quarters because of the supplier delay.

TICKET #D-4471 — Admin dashboard dark-mode rollout blocked by locked vault

The Pellworth admin dashboard's dark-mode theme tokens are stored in the Glintvault instance, which auto-locked after three failed syncs overnight. On-call: please unlock the vault before the morning deploy so the theming pipeline can read the palette secrets. Use the recovery passphrase recorded just below to unseal it.

recovery phrase for kawep-kawep: caseth-gorael-quenmir-olieth-ulavan-fenwyn-eliix-fraox-zorok

**Action Item: Chunked rendering defaults for DiffLantern**

During the Q3 incident, DiffLantern attempted to render a 900 MB diff in one pass, exhausting browser memory for several reviewers. New team members should know we now stream diffs in fixed-size chunks with a hard cap on hunks rendered before virtualization kicks in. The Velmora team owns these values and revisits them quarterly. The current tuning constants are listed below.

tuning constants:
QUOTAS = {
    "quenael": 10,
    "oliwyn": 1,
}